RHASIDAT Adeleke is set to run the 200 metres at the London Diamond League this Saturday – just days after her late withdrawal from competing in Monaco.
The European 400 metres silver medalist will drop down the distance to race over a half lap against Olympic silver medalist Julien Alfred and training partner Dina Asher-Smith.


Adeleke was due to compete in the Monaco Diamond League last Friday but withdrew though no reason was given for the decision.
But it came after her fourth place finish at the Diamond League in Eugene when she ran 51.33 seconds – her slowest 400 metres of the year and two seconds outside her national record.
European Indoor 3000 metre champion Sarah Healy is also in action in London as she competes in the mile along with Sophie O’Sullivan.
But they face stiff competition from Dutch superstar Sifan Hasan and Olympic silver medalist Jessica Hull.
And Mark English is running in the 800 metres as he looks to continue his good form that saw him go under 1 minute 44 seconds for the first time last month.
But he is a top field that also includes six of the eight finalists at last year’s Paris Olympics, including gold medalist Emmanuel Wanyoni.
